
Yerevan Outpaces Rome and Paris in Russian Tourist Bookings This Summer

On August 21, OneTwoTrip analysts reported that Yerevan entered the list of one of the most popular destinations for Russians this summer. A total of 4.3% of bookings were made for a trip to the capital of Armenia in the current summer season. Yerevan has become more popular this year by 34.4% compared to last year.
The Armenian capital took the second place by this indicator, yielding to Istanbul. Rome is in the third place. Paris, Rimini, Dubai, Antalya, Bangkok, Budapest, and Milan were also included in the Russians' top 10 tourist preferences.
Over 1 million tourists visited Armenia in the first seven months of 2023. The highest activity was recorded in July - 255,706 visits, the lowest in February - 130,588. Most tourists in the mentioned period arrived in Armenia from Russia - 51% (644 thousand) and Georgia - 11% (138 thousand).
